What is Backlinking?

Also known as inbound links, backlinks are incoming links to your website or web pages. On a specific webpage a link to a different website will be highlighted, and by clicking on that link you will be diverted to another website/webpage. Likewise, a different website can feature links to specific pages of your site.

What are the Benefits of Quality Backlinks?

Strategic  

Backlinking plays a strategic role in the entire ranking algorithm process for all search engines. If two sites are very similar in nature then the search engine will search for quality inbound links, which will boost your SEO results significantly. Likewise, if your site links to a bad website then this will have detrimental impact on your SEO.

Attracts Search Engines

Backlinks also attract search engines to your site, provided those links are of a high quality. In this respect quality prevails over quantity, so a single high quality backlink is more effective than a dozen poor links, thus helping your site to perform better as a result. 

Used by most Search Engines

It’s not just Google that focuses on the importance of backlinking in SEO. Other search engines including Bing and Yahoo analyse links when determining the ranking of a website.

Attracts more Users

Backlinking is also important from a human perspective, attracting more users to your website. You can place backlinks on blogs, forums and other credible sources to enhance the popularity of your site and attract a wider network of users.

Enhances Credibility

Another benefit of backlinking is that, by linking to relevant and popular websites, you can easily enhance the credibility of your site in the complex world of the web.
